Can You Bring Nicotine Pouches on a Plane? A 2025 Guide for Travelers
With TSA rules, luggage restrictions, and varying international regulations, air travel often raises lots of questions—especially for nicotine pouch users. So, can you bring products like ZYN on a plane?
Short Answer: Yes, You Can!
Whether flying domestically or internationally, nicotine pouches are generally allowed in both carry-on and checked baggage. However, in-flight use and legality at your destination may vary, so it’s smart to double-check before your trip.
Traveling Within the US
The TSA does not restrict smokeless nicotine products, meaning you can carry nicotine pouches in both your checked and carry-on bags without special packing. There’s no strict limit on how many you can bring for personal use, but carrying large amounts may raise suspicion of resale—which is illegal and punishable by law.
Airline Policies on Nicotine Pouches (as of May 2025)
Airline |
Possession of Nicotine Pouches Allowed |
In-Flight Use |
American Airlines | Yes | Generally prohibited; confirm with crew |
Alaska Airlines | Yes | Not allowed; check with crew |
United Airlines | Yes | Not allowed
|
Spirit | Yes | Not allowed |
Southwest | Yes | Not clearly stated; ask staff |
Delta | Yes | Not allowed |
JetBlue | Yes | Not clearly stated; ask staff |
Tip: Even if you can bring them, don’t assume you can use them during the flight. Always check with your airline in advance.
Flying Internationally with ZYN or Similar Products
Rules vary by country. Here's a quick look at the current status (May 2025):
Country | Allowed? | Notes |
---|---|---|
Mexico | Yes | |
Spain | Yes | |
Italy | Yes | |
UK | Yes | |
Canada | Limited | Max 4mg strength & 90-day supply |
Iceland | Yes | |
Germany | Yes | |
Portugal | Yes | |
Croatia | Yes |
Important: Regulations change often — always check the official government website of your destination before you travel.

Other Travel: Cruises & Trains
-
Cruises: Most lines allow personal use of nicotine pouches. Since there’s no smoke or vapor, you usually don’t need a designated smoking area. Just dispose of them properly.
-
Trains (US): Nicotine pouch use is generally permitted—offering a good alternative where smoking and vaping are banned.
